4. Critical Success Factors<br />

The project has identified critical factors, (including technical, business, market, regulatory, and legal<br />

factors) that impact the potential technical and commercial success of the project<br />

The project has presented adequate plans to recognize, address, and overcome these factors<br />

The project has the opportunity to advance the state of technology and impact the viability of commercial<br />

algal biomass feedstock supply and conversion, through one or more of the following:<br />

i. Cross-Cutting Analysis (ex. economic analysis, sustainability analysis, resource assessments, risk<br />

assessments)<br />

ii. Feedstock Supply R&D (ex. biology, cultivation, resource use, biomass characteristics,<br />

harvesting/dewatering)<br />

iii. Downstream Refining R&D (ex. extraction, conversion, fuel, products, fuel/product infrastructure and<br />

end-use)<br />

iv. Environmental sustainability (example: water use, GMOs, energy consumption)<br />

<strong>Reviewer</strong> <strong>Comments</strong><br />

<strong>Reviewer</strong>: 1 Criteria Score: 6<br />

The CSFs and Challenges are adequately explained.<br />

<strong>Reviewer</strong>: 2 Criteria Score: 5<br />

This model effort needs additional input data. One factor not yet included that is important is the effect of<br />

sealevel rise and predicted climate change, in general. This should be incorporated as a sensitivity<br />

analysis.<br />

<strong>Reviewer</strong>: 3 Criteria Score: 4<br />

Integration of on-site feedstock production and harvesting logistics assessments into full lifecycle analysis<br />

<strong>Reviewer</strong>: 4 Criteria Score: 6<br />

See Overall Impression text.<br />

<strong>Reviewer</strong>: 5 Criteria Score: 6<br />

Critical success factors were identified but it will be a major challenge to make the model truly useful.<br />

How to develop a model with enough depth in the different modules so that it is practical (and not just an<br />

exercise in modeling using GIS overlays)?<br />

<strong>Reviewer</strong>: 6 Criteria Score: 7<br />

I saw no problems here.<br />

<strong>Reviewer</strong>: 7 Criteria Score: 6<br />

The scope of the model is so vast that critical success factors include focusing on key leverage items<br />

where there are gaps in current knowledge and in the selection and incorporation of best available exisitng<br />

data and models. For example, it appears that the processing component of the logistic model could be<br />

improved and moved forward by using NREL modeling.<br />
